The Role Working on behalf of the major multimedia provider , you will be responsible for making outbound calls to new and existing customers. The campaign is split into 4 sub-campaigns: · Prospect – Contacting potential customers to discuss the current offers with and offer the best deals and packages to suit the customer’s needs. · Value – Contacting existing/previous customers who have recently cancelled part of their package and offering exclusive deals and offers for the customer to reinstate their package. · Upgrades – Contacting existing customers to perform an account review and ensure they are getting the best value for money, whilst also meeting the customers needs and offering additional products and services. · Welcome Back – Contacting previous customers who have cancelled their package and offering the best deals and special offers available to win the customer back and join up to again. In all campaigns of the role, you will primarily be discussing TV packages (Sports, Cinema, Netflix, Disney+), with the opportunity to upsell on broadband packages. A great amount of rapport must be built with the customers to ensure you perform an effective needs analysis to offer the most suitable packages. Shifts 10am till 7pm - Monday to Friday.
